My Khê / An Thượng

Da Nang, Vietnam · Neighborhood Guide

Da Nang's beachfront expat strip — seafood restaurants, Western cafés, yoga studios, surf shops, and a long promenade right on Vietnam's best urban beach.

My Khê / An Thượng at a Glance

Mid-Range

Cost Level

7,500,000–13,750,000 VND/month ($300–$550)

Rent Range

Very safe — beach community with expat-oriented businesses. Low crime. Safe for solo women walking at night along the lit beach promenade.

Safety

60–120 Mbps fibre from FPT and VNPT in most apartments. Beachfront serviced apartments have reliable connections.

Internet

Who Lives in My Khê / An Thượng?

International digital nomads (especially from Europe and US), Korean and Chinese tourists/residents, surfers, yoga teachers, and Vietnamese hospitality workers. Average age 25–38.

Living in My Khê / An Thượng — Practical Details

Walkability

Good — An Thượng area is a compact, walkable grid of cafés, restaurants, and shops. Beach promenade is excellent for walking and cycling. Very pedestrian-friendly by Vietnamese standards.

Grocery & Food Access

An Thượng Market for fresh local produce. Vinmart on the main strip. Big C Da Nang (10 min ride) for bulk shopping. Several Western import shops on An Thượng street.

Getting Around

  • Grab: 15,000–30,000 VND to city center or Dragon Bridge
  • Bicycle: flat terrain, dedicated lanes along the beach — best way to commute
  • Motorbike rental: $40–$60/month
  • Walking: most daily needs within 15 min walk

Nearby Coworking

  • The Lab Da Nang (1.875M VND/mo)
  • Toong Da Nang (1.75M VND/mo)
  • Enouvo Space (1.5M VND/mo)

Insider Tips for My Khê / An Thượng

  • 1An Thượng is nicknamed 'the backpacker street' but has evolved — now has excellent specialty coffee and restaurants
  • 2Surf season is September–March with 1–2m waves — My Khê Surf School rents boards for 100,000 VND/hour
  • 3Rent a few streets back from the beachfront (An Thượng 30 or 32) for 30% savings with a 3-minute walk to sand
  • 4The Dragon Bridge breathes fire every Saturday and Sunday night at 9pm — Da Nang's signature experience, best viewed from the beach side
